Indigenous games, tug of war as part of 100 Drums Wangala

TURA: District Sports Officer, O B Mawthoh has informed that Indigenous Games and Open Tug of War competition is being organised by the organising committee of the Hundred Drums Wangala Festival at Asanang on November 8 from 10 am.

The games scheduled for the event are Jakpong Pe’a, An’ding Oka, Wa’pong Sika, Rong’ma Chilsusaa and Rong’ma Gosusaa.

The notification informed that there will be no entry fee and interested individuals and teams are requested to register their names at the venue on the said date and time.
